:Product: Report of Solar-Geophysical Activity

:Issued: 2011 Dec 26 2200 UTC

# Prepared jointly by the U.S. Dept. of Commerce, NOAA,

# Space Weather Prediction Center and the U.S. Air Force.

#

Joint USAF/NOAA Report of Solar and Geophysical Activity

SDF Number 360 Issued at 2200Z on 26 Dec 2011

IA.  Analysis of Solar Active Regions and Activity from  25/2100Z

to 26/2100Z:  Solar activity has been at moderate levels for the past

24 hour. Region 1387 (S22W42) has produced two M-class flares, the

largest being an M2/Sf event at 26/2030Z. Region 1387 continues to

grow, in areal coverage and magnetic complexity as it rotates into a

more geoeffective location. Region 1386 (S17E37) also continues to

grow and evolve. A proton enhancement at geosynchronous orbit was

observed by the GOES 13 spacecraft, with a max flux of 3 pfu at

26/0135. This enhancement appears to be correlated to the M4/1n

flare from Region 1387 on 25 December. Protons were again at

background level at the time of this report. Over the past 36 hours,

5 CME's have been observed in STEREO and LASCO C2 and C3 imagery.

Three CME's were associated with eruptive filaments and two were

associated with flares from Region 1387. Of these five CME's two are

forecast to become geoeffective.

IB.  Solar Activity Forecast:  Solar activity is expected to be at

moderate levels with a slight chance for X-class events for the next

three days (27 - 29 December).

IIA.  Geophysical Activity Summary 25/2100Z to 26/2100Z:

The geomagnetic field has been at quiet levels for the past 24 hours.

IIB.  Geophysical Activity Forecast:  The geomagnetic field is

expected to remain at predominantly quiet levels on day one (27

December). An increase to quiet to active levels with a chance for

an isolated minor storm period on days two and three (28 -29

December) is expected as two CME's, from filament eruptions on 25

December and 26 December, are expected to arrive on 28 December and

early on 29 December,  respectfully.
